Default Golden Tile Fish 3-15

Well we left from Stuart bright and early at 6 AM. Went out to a “secret” spot and started to deep drop. This was Rick Bode’s (my father –in-law) first time fishing like this. We used a electramate reel and dropped a series of hooks waaaay down deep. Then after we saw the rod bumping, up it came. Nice Golden Tile Fish. We easily caught or limit and Rick caught the biggest one at 16.5 lbs. Not too bad for a newbie….Hope you enjoy the pics.

Richard - thanks! With a 5-1/2 knot current, a nasty short chop out of the SSW and a difficult time finding out what depth the Tileys were in, we had our work cut out for us.

I think I'm gonna wait two weeks until the week after the Full Moon when the current is usually its slowest before I try again.
